Why Your 4K Projector Colors Might Be Off

The first time I faced this problem, I assumed it was a defect or a faulty unit. Turns out, several factors can cause color distortion, including incorrect color calibration, HDMI settings, or even the environment’s lighting conditions. Sometimes, even the cables or misconfigured projectors can lead to a washed-out or overly saturated look. Adjust Your Projector Settings for Vivid Colors

My first attempt involved diving into the menu blindly, clicking through dozens of options. I started with the color temperature, which controls the overall tone of the picture. Set it to ‘Warm’ for a more natural look or ‘Cool’ for crisp, bluish hues. I adjusted this by navigating to the ‘Picture Settings’ menu and selecting the ‘Color Temperature’ option, then choosing the appropriate preset. Once I got it close to natural, I moved on to individual color sliders for red, green, and blue to fine-tune the hue balance. A quick tip: if your projector supports presets for different environments, like ‘Cinema’ or ‘Game,’ start there as a baseline. This hands-on approach corrected the washed-out look I was battling.

Utilize Built-in Calibration Tools for Precision

Most high-end projectors come with built-in calibration features, which are invaluable once you’ve mastered basic adjustments. I accessed my projector’s calibration menu and ran the color calibration wizard. It guides you through displaying test patterns and adjusting color points accurately. During one session, I projected the pattern onto a blank wall and followed the prompts to tweak the red and blue channels to match the reference on-screen. The result was a significant leap in color accuracy—deep blacks and vibrant skin tones. If your projector doesn’t have this feature, an affordable calibration disc can serve a similar purpose, providing color strips and patterns to guide your adjustments. Proper calibration ensures your display reproduces colors faithfully, making movies look true-to-life.

Calibrate Your HDMI Settings for Consistent Quality

Beyond the internal settings, HDMI parameters can greatly affect color output. I inspected my HDMI cable connections, ensuring they were plugged into the correct HDMI ports with high-speed support for 4K HDR content. Then, I accessed my projector’s HDMI settings, setting the color depth to 12-bit where possible, and enabling any HDR modes available. I also verified my source device settings—my Blu-ray player had to be configured to output 4K HDR properly. A common mistake is using a low-quality or incompatible HDMI cable, which can cause washed-out images or color banding. Clean and Check Your Cables for Hidden Faults

One overlooked cause of color issues can be dirty or damaged cables. I once experienced a sudden dullness in images—after inspecting, I found a small pinched point in my HDMI cable that caused interference. Carefully disconnecting and visually inspecting the cable for fraying or bent pins helped identify the culprit. Using compressed air to clean connectors prevented dust buildup, which can also disrupt signal quality. If your cables are several years old, consider replacing them with certified high-speed HDMI cables. I replaced mine with a well-reviewed cable, following this guide to ensure optimal compatibility. A clean, secure connection prevents loss of color-depth and blurring, delivering crisp visuals every time.

Fine-Tuning in Ambient Environment

Ambient lighting can influence how colors look on the big screen. I noticed that glare and reflections made my whites look dull. Using indirect lighting and controlling window light drastically improved contrast and color richness. Darkening the room, adding neutral-colored curtains, and using matte wall paints minimized external reflections. This environment adjustment turned my dull images into vibrant, eye-catching displays, making every scene pop with true color. Proper room lighting is vital for appreciating the calibration efforts you’ve invested in your projector setup.

Regularly Reassess and Maintain Your Settings

Colors can shift over time due to lamp aging or environmental changes. I set a reminder to revisit my calibration every six months, repeating these steps to maintain optimal quality. A quick recalibration after replacing the lamp ensures consistent color reproduction. Keeping cables clean and checking connections periodically prevents degradation. Small, consistent maintenance ensures your projector continues delivering stunning, vibrant images that do justice to your viewing experience.

My Personal Toolkit for Home Display Care

One device I swear by is the X-Rite i1Display Pro, a professional-grade colorimeter I use monthly to recalibrate my OLED TVs and projectors. Its precise luminance and color measurement capabilities ensure consistent picture quality and help me spot subtle shifts before they become obvious or problematic, like the gradual brightness drop often experienced with OLED panels. Complementing this, I use HCFR Colormeter, an open-source calibration software ideal for fine-tuning display color profiles without the need for costly professional calibration services.

For resolution and cable checks, I rely on the AVPro Edge HDMI Analyzer. It helps verify if my HDMI cables support the full bandwidth for 4K or 8K signals, preventing issues like color banding or flickers. Additionally, regular cleaning tools such as compressed air cans and microfiber cloths prevent dust buildup that can weaken signals or degrade image quality over time.

How do I maintain my displays over time?

Regular calibration is key. I recommend scheduling a monthly check using your colorimeter to ensure color accuracy and brightness uniformity, particularly for OLEDs susceptible to pixel aging. Cleaning cables and connectors with proper tools like contact cleaner and compressed air prevents signal degradation that can cause discoloration or flicker. For physically mounted displays, inspect mount tightness and levelness every few months to avoid skewed images or hardware stress, referencing guides like this article for proper mounting techniques. Finally, keeping software and firmware updated ensures your display benefits from recent performance improvements, security patches, and calibration features.
